iTunes Store Tops Three Billion Songs
Music fans have now downloaded and purchased more than three billion songs from the iTunes Store, and “we’d like to thank all of our customers who have contributed to this incredible milestone,” said Eddy Cue, Apple’s vice president of iTunes. The world’s most popular online music, TV, and movie store, iTunes features a catalog of more than five million songs, 550 TV shows, and 500 movies, and it recently surpassed both Amazon and Target to become the third largest music retailer in the US.

Add seven songs , Two music video and nemurous Video Podcasts in that from me .. I like iTunes Store because I can download free video Podcasts ... some of which are not available in india, there are lynda tutorials , Photoshop tutorials and tips and tricks.. also G4 TV . I download it all .

But same is not the case with iTunes software.. a real resource hogger

@saurav.. I think iTunes was the first online music store.

Other music stored I havent used like Urge or the local Indian stores. The indian stores have rediculous licence terms..
One can play the music file that are bought only on the computer where it was purchased. But in iTunes its not that case. you can play purchased music on any 5 authorised computers.
